1.The switch is spring-loaded, non-directional vibration sensor trigger switch can be triggered at any angle;
2.When the switch is in the OFF state is open at rest, when subjected to external vibration touch to achieve the appropriate force, or moving away from the speed of the appropriate (partial) effort, conductive pin will produce an instant turn-on was an instant ON state; disappear when the external force , switch back to the open-OFF state;
